Hello federmassimi, WOW! It looks a bit like a HDR movie shot. So far, we do not know the reason given to you for the rejection. It is easier to talk about a specific reason rather than take a guess. If you were standing in this place and the light was just like the photo shows, you had to be impressed and excited to capture it.

Guidelines for contributors should be studied to be sure you have not just created a work of art  - that is more than most buyers want. The intensity of the colors and shadows are such that buyers would want to change these to softer lighting for stock. Most buyers want to manipulate the settings and do extreme color changes to suit their project.

I will leave it here until you send us the reason(s) for the rejection of this photo. For now, look at these guidelines and get to know them. Best regards, JH
